Very clean 1984 Yamaha RZ350 Kenny Roberts special.  7784 original miles (may be higher at end of auction, I do take it out to keep it healthy).  Fresh tires, brake fluid flushed and replaced, new battery, both fork seals replaced and forks cleaned and serviced, coolant system flushed, oil changed, fuel tank cleaned and sealed, carburetors disassembled and cleaned, etc.  Basically a front to back by my local Yamaha dealer, done in the past 60 days. Tons of fun to ride and definitely an eye catcher.  Also has Toomey exhausts, although I have the stock ones as well as a decent amount of spare parts, spare keys, and an original maintenance manual.  Comes with a new battery tender.  Fresh PA inspection, too.  It is 30 years old, so it's got a few small dings on the tank, please look at the photos but it's about as good as possible for this really cool bike.  A very nice RZ close to my location (with 2100 miles) just sold for $8150, so the buy it now makes this a bargain.

See Britain's land speed record hopeful at Race Retro 2010

Tue, 09 Mar 2010

SEE THE MACHINE that could propel Britain to a new motorcycle land speed world record at The Race Retro 2010 show, held at Stoneleigh Park, Coventry from 12th to 14th March. Almost a year has passed since Visordown broke the news of the planned UK assault on the land speed record - this coming August the Angelic Bulldog team travels to Bonneville, where it is hoping to smash the 400mph barrier and bring the motorcycle Land Speed Record back to the UK for the first time since 1937. The current record stands at 360.913mph over a kilometre.

Yamaha Reports Q2 2011 Results

Wed, 03 Aug 2011

A drop in net sales, an appreciating yen and the fallout from the March 11 earthquake and tsunamis in Japan contributed to a 4.6% drop in profit for Yamaha Motor Co. over the second quarter of 2011. Over the quarter ended June 30, 2011, Yamaha saw a 5.9% drop in net sales compared to the same period in 2010.Yamaha reports sales of 344.5 billion yen (US$4.48 billion) over the second quarter, compared to the 366.3 billion yen (US$4.77 billion) reported in the same quarter in 2010.

Three-Time World Champion Wayne Rainey Honored At Quail Motorcycle Gathering

Thu, 09 May 2013

Saturday, May 4 marked the 5th annual Quail Motorcycle Gathering in Carmel, California. With such a diverse collection of historical, rare and outrageous motorcycles, the Quail is an event we thoroughly enjoyed attending last year. To commemorate the occasion, this year’s guest of honor was none other than three-time 500cc Grand Prix world champion, and local area resident, Wayne Rainey.
